首页 -> 登录 -> 注册 -> 回复主题 -> 发表主题
光行天下 -> ZEMAX,OpticStudio -> zemax中利用ZPL计算衍射光学元件(DOE)的表面轮廓 [点此返回论坛查看本帖完整版本] [打印本页]

奉同学 2023-11-29 18:25

zemax中利用ZPL计算衍射光学元件(DOE)的表面轮廓

本文ZPL宏可用于计算旋转对称 Kinoform 透镜表面(OpticStudio 中为 Binary2 面型)的相位(phase)以及矢高(Sag)。使用者需在运行宏前输入半径(Radius)每隔多长时间重复计算一次,之后宏会计算出每个半径值对应的矢高并给出相应的衍射区域编号(Zone number)、步长(Step Size)、每个区域所在的位置半径(Zone Radius)、每个区域内/外半径矢高(Sag with inner/outer radius)。除此以外,该宏还会计算出每个区域的轮廓频率(Profile Frequency,单位为waves/mm)作为生产难易的评估参数。 ZiR },F/  
输入 4Js2/s  
输入表面编号以及迭代半径间隔就可以计算出表面矢高。如下图所示: ]0[Gc \h}  
B=<>OYH  
[attachment=123244]
<jt_<p +  
这里迭代半径间隔怎么算的,也就是它输入半径(Radius)每隔多长时间重复计算一次
对丶白 2024-05-03 15:47
附件呢?
谭健 2024-05-04 10:15
不断学习进步
查看本帖完整版本: [-- zemax中利用ZPL计算衍射光学元件(DOE)的表面轮廓 --] [-- top --]

Copyright © 2005-2024 光行天下 蜀ICP备06003254号-1 网站统计